Abstract

本实用新型公开了一种建筑钢筋打磨装置,包括底座、支撑梁和横梁,所述支撑梁连接在底座的左侧上端,所述横梁横向连接在支撑梁的右侧上端,所述横梁的下端安装有传送带,且传送带表面固定有砂纸,所述支撑梁的中部固定有控制装置,所述底座的表面安装有液压杆,且液压杆右侧的底座上固定有液压泵,所述液压杆的上端连接有支撑板,所述支撑板上端通过减震弹簧固定有打磨板,所述打磨板上开设有凹槽。本实用新型通过设置有一个打磨板,并且在打磨板上开设有多个凹槽,在使用时可以将多个钢筋放在凹槽内,然后使用传送带上的砂纸将钢筋表面打磨干净,打磨速度快,具有较高的打磨效率,且操作简单,较为实用,适合广泛推广与使用。

This utility model discloses a steel bar grinding device, including a base, a support beam, and a crossbeam. The support beam is connected to the upper left side of the base, and the crossbeam is horizontally connected to the upper right side of the support beam. A conveyor belt is installed at the lower end of the crossbeam, and sandpaper is fixed on the surface of the conveyor belt. A control device is fixed in the middle of the support beam. A hydraulic rod is installed on the surface of the base, and a hydraulic pump is fixed on the base to the right of the hydraulic rod. A support plate is connected to the upper end of the hydraulic rod, and a grinding plate is fixed to the upper end of the support plate by a shock-absorbing spring. The grinding plate has grooves. This utility model, by setting a grinding plate with multiple grooves, allows multiple steel bars to be placed in the grooves, and then the sandpaper on the conveyor belt is used to grind the surface of the steel bars clean. It has a fast grinding speed, high grinding efficiency, simple operation, and is practical and suitable for widespread promotion and use.

Description

A kind of building iron grinding device
Technical field
The utility model relates to building iron field, in particular to a kind of building iron grinding device.
Background technique
Currently, construction refers to the production activity of engineering construction implementation phase, it is the building course of all kinds of buildings, It can be described as the various lines on design drawing, in specified place, become process in kind, it includes that foundation engineering is applied Work, main structure construction, roof construction, decorative engineering construction etc..The place of construction operation is known as " construction site " Or " construction site " is cried, building site is also cried, existing reinforcing bar milling tools can only carry out the polishing of single reinforcing bar, and operator needs Replacement reinforcing bar carries out sanding operation repeatedly, and grinding efficiency is lower.Therefore, it is proposed that a kind of building iron grinding device.

Specific embodiment
To be easy to understand the technical means, creative features, achievement of purpose, and effectiveness of the utility model, below In conjunction with specific embodiment, the utility model is further described.
As shown in Figs. 1-2, a kind of building iron grinding device, including pedestal 1, supporting beam 2 and crossbeam 3, the supporting beam 2 It is connected to the left side upper end of pedestal 1, the crossbeam 3 is connected laterally at the right side upper end of supporting beam 2, the lower end peace of the crossbeam 3 Equipped with conveyer belt 7, and 7 surface of conveyer belt is fixed with sand paper 6, and the middle part of the supporting beam 2 is fixed with control device 4, the bottom The surface of seat 1 is equipped with hydraulic stem 5, and is fixed with hydraulic pump 12, the upper end of the hydraulic stem 5 on the pedestal 1 on 5 right side of hydraulic stem It is connected with support plate 11,11 upper end of support plate is fixed with polishing plate 9 by damping spring 10, opens up on the polishing plate 9 Fluted 8, idler wheel 16 is mounted on the polishing plate 9 of 8 two sides of groove, the bottom of the groove 8 is fixed with driving wheel 15, And driving wheel 15 is sequentially connected by driving motor 13 fixed on the right side of belt 14 and plate 9 of polishing.
Wherein, the hydraulic stem 5 is multiple, and the hydraulic input terminal of multiple hydraulic stems 5 is hydraulic defeated with hydraulic pump 12 Outlet connection.
Wherein, the damping spring 10 is multiple, and multiple damping springs 10 are evenly distributed on polishing 9 lower end of plate.
Wherein, the groove 8 is multiple, and multiple grooves 8 are evenly distributed on polishing 9 surface of plate.
Wherein, the control device 4 is electrically connected with hydraulic pump 12, driving motor 13 and conveyer belt 7.
Working principle: being connected to power supply for control device 4 when use, and then controlling hydraulic pump 12 support hydraulic stem 5 will Plate 11 and polishing plate 9 are put down, and then the reinforcing bar polished will be needed to be placed in groove 8, and controlling hydraulic pump 12 again makes hydraulic stem 5 It rises, contacts reinforcing bar with 6 surface of sand paper, then start conveyer belt 7 and driving motor 13, reinforcing bar do relative motion with sand paper 6, It is clean to which rebar surface be polished, hydraulic pump 12 can be made to put down 5 company of repeating above operation of hydraulic stem after polishing Continuous polishing work.
